The BZG04-36-HM3-08 operates based on the Zener effect, where it maintains a constant voltage drop across its terminals by allowing current to flow in reverse bias conditions. This ensures a stable output voltage within the specified tolerance range.
The BZG04-36-HM3-08 finds extensive use in various electronic applications, including: - Voltage stabilization in power supplies - Overvoltage protection in communication systems - Signal conditioning in sensor interfaces
